Easy Unlocking

Smart keys can unlock doors and turn off the ignition and perform other tasks without the driver needing to press buttons. Instead, the key's sensors in the integrated system transmit a radio signal to the vehicle when it's in distance, which can be confirmed by one of the antennas on the bodywork of the car or inside the cabin.

Certain key features of the car can be modified based on the model and the make of the vehicle. You can customize the seating positions as well as the position of the steering wheel, mirror settings, climate control (e.g. temperature) settings along with stereo presets, and more. Mercedes-Benz for instance has a system known as Keyless Go which allows drivers to keep their key fobs in pocket, and be able to open the trunk or start the car.
